#370871 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#370871 is composed of 21.6% red, 3.1%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 266.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 23.7%. #370871 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e10e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#370871 color description : Very dark violet.
#370871 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#370871 has RGB values of R:55, G:8,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 3606641.

Shades and Tints of #370871
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f6f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#370871
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3b3e is the less saturated color, while #370376 is the most saturated one.
